Bishop Johnson Jr 1946 - 2007

Bishop Johnson Jr of Ypsilanti, Washtenaw County, MI was born on June 9, 1946, and died at age 60 years old on April 21, 2007. Bishop Johnson was buried at Jefferson Barracks National Cemetery Section 1Z Site 144 2900 Sheridan Road, in St. Louis, Mo.

In 1946, in the year that Bishop Johnson Jr was born, on July 4th, the Philippines gained independence from the United States. In 1964, Independence Day in the Philippines was moved from July 4th to June 12th at the insistence of nationalists and historians.

In 1954, when this person was just 8 years old, on May 17th, the Supreme Court released a decision on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ka. The ruling stated that state laws establishing separate public schools for black and white students was unconstitutional thus paving the way for integration in schools.
